Transaction 507c66ec1b12e59a3c88bbe8213ee21cb92cdfedb868b6e901831bd4b276aa4f
1 Input
1 Output
-
507c66ec1b12e59a3c88bbe8213ee21cb92cdfedb868b6e901831bd4b276aa4f:0
- value
- 14898
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 42508fed3737942666c31d78edd7807ccab4a82f OP_EQUAL
- address
- 37jf2mLeh3M8b53kn1jSAJD6fEAmurx5jP